Joshua McNall

Joshua M. McNall (PhD, Manchester) is associate professor of pastoral theology at Oklahoma Wesleyan University, where he also serves as director of the Honors College. He is the author of several books, including How Jesus Saves: Atonement for Ordinary People (Zondervan), Perhaps: Reclaiming the Space between Doubt and Dogmatism (IVP Academic), and The Mosaic of Atonement: An Integrated Approach to Christ’s Work (Zondervan Academic). Josh and his wife Brianna have four children: Lucy, Penelope, Ewan, and Teddy.
